29 CFR 1910.107(b)(5)(iv): Space within the spray booth on the downstream and upstream sides of filters were not protected with approved automatic sprinklers: (a) Paint Shop -The painter operated a spray booth that was observed not having a sprinkler system installed within its space, on or about 8/28/2013. 29 CFR 1910.107(b)(9): A clear space of not less than 3 feet on all sides was not kept free from storage or combustible construction: Paint Shop - A 55-gallon drum marked flammable and containing Ultra Kleen Solution was stored within approximately one foot next to the spray booth, on or about 8/28/2013.

29 CFR 1910.107(g)(2): All spraying areas were not kept as free from the accumulation of deposits of combustible residues as practical, with cleaning conducted daily if necessary: (a) Paint Shop - Overspray deposits from spray finishing operations were observed on the walls of the spray booth and throughout the paint storage area, on or about 8/28/2013.

29 CFR 1910.107(d)(2): All spraying areas were not provided with mechanical ventilation adequate to remove flammable vapors, mists, or powders to a safe location and to confine and control combustible residues so that life is not endangered. (a) Paint Shop - The spray booth mechanical ventilation ductwork was incomplete and open with parts missing thus making it inadequate in removing exhaust air from the space when the painter was conducting spray finishing applications, on or about 8/28/2013. 29 CFR 1910.134(e)(1): The employer did not provide a medical evaluation to determine the employee's ability to use a respirator, before the employee was fit tested or required to use the respirator in the workplace (a) Garage - The painter had not been provided the required medical evaluation upon being provided with and required by the employer to wear a 3M Model tight-fitting respirator while conducting spray finishing operations, on or about 8/20/2013. 29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): The employer did not develop, implement and maintain at the workplace, a written hazard communication program which at least describes how the criteria specified in paragraphs (f), (g) and (h) of this section for labels and other forms of warning, material safety data sheets, and employee information and training will be met: (a) Paint Shop - A painter conducting auto body repair operations was not informed and trained on the hazards in using hazardous chemical products including but not limited to Ultra Kleen Spray Equipment Soultion, a product containing xylene, on or about 8/28/2013.
